Wood County Hospital Clinical Nurse Technician Externship offers new RN graduates the opportunity to gain experience in an acute care setting while preparing for the NCLEX examination. Under the supervision of an experienced RN, CNT-Es will administer direct and indirect care to patients ranging from neonate to geriatric. This position enables new RN graduates to gain critical thinking skills while delivering safe, quality and compassionate care to patients across various departments. Job Duties:

  • Perform initial assessment of patients.
  • Formulate nursing diagnoses and establish nursing care plan based on admission assessments.
  • Develop and implement teaching/discharge plans in nursing care plan and review daily.
  • Involve patient/family/significant others in planning care with consideration for the individual's uniqueness, existing knowledge, skills and behaviors and how they affect ability to benefit from plan.
  • Care for routine short stay and inpatient medical/surgical patients who may require monitoring.

Benefit of our Transition to Practice Program:

  • Immediate ability to begin working prior to taking the NCLEX
  • Individualized mentoring by an experienced RN
  • Facilitated by a highly skilled RN preceptor and allows for ongoing nursing education 
  • The preceptor will help guide the employee through unit specific policies, procedures and coaching plans
